WebJan 30, 2024 · Faraday’s first law of electrolysis states that the mass of any substance deposited or liberated at an electrode is directly proportional to the quantity of electricity passed through the electrolyte (solution or melt). Thus, if \ ( {\rm {W}}\) gram of the substance is deposited on passing \ ( {\rm {Q}}\) coulombs of electricity, then.

Electrolytes are the aqueous solution of chemical substance like acid, base and salt which conduct electricity in aqueous medium. For examples:- Aqueous solution of H 2 SO 4, NaOH, NaCl, etc. Electrolytes are ionized into charged particles (ie.
